最近在整理内容的时候看了一些关于css布局的内容,虽然都是很常见的属性,但是长时间的浅显的使用方式导致自己忘记了很多深层的含义,今天就记录一下margin-left的使用
<style>
.out {
width: 100%;
height: 500px;
background-color: pink;
}
.inner {
width: 100px;
height: 100%;
background-color: skyblue;
margin-left: 100%;
margin-left:100px;
}
</style>
<div class="out">
<div class="inner"></div>
</div>
当使用margin-left:100px的时候是元素相对于自己的父级盒子的内边距的距离,当使用的100%的时候这是的参照是所在的父级元素的宽度